The Competency Based Training Fund represents Component I of the Skills for the Future Programme, which was designed to support the Barbados Human Resource Development (HRD) Strategy. The Strategy supported the development and operationalization of National and Caribbean Vocational Qualifications and the implementation of the proposed National Qualifications Framework (NQF) for Barbados.
The HRD Strategy Milestone Ceremony took place on May 13, 2017 to highlight the achievements under the Strategy. The Competency Based Training Fund was highlighted under the theme “Competency-Based Education and Training" along with the Technical and Vocational Education and Training (TVET) Council.
